Crane scale is a special measuring equipment developed for the special requirements of loading and unloading operations such as ladle, hot metal ladle and grab bucket in metallurgy and foundry. It is mainly used for weighing of process or inter-factory settlement, and the accuracy is usually ±0.2~0.5%(full scale). According to the structure type, it is divided into two categories: roller type and track type. The two Weighing modules and installation forms are different, but they are equipped with special instruments for crane scales. The roller crane scale is mainly composed of a pair of fishback weighing sensors and weighing instruments. The fishback weighing module is mounted on the trolley under the fixed pulley shaft or weighing shaft, each shaft is equipped with 2 weighing sensors. The sensor measures the tension of the wire rope on the pulley, and the weighing meter can convert the weight of the load being lifted. Rail crane scales usually consist of four rail weight sensors and weighing instruments. Four sections of track are cut off under the four wheels of the car, and a weighing sensor is installed at the cut space. The height and width of the sensor and track are the same. The trolley is driven to the sensor, and the scale body can measure the weight of the heavy object being lifted. The crane Electronic scale is mainly composed of weighing sensor, weighing body structure, junction box, instrument and so on. The signal of the load cell is transmitted to the load cell in the driver's cab through a junction box and a double-shielded signal cable. In addition to the conventional functions of zero clearing, peeling, accumulation, printing, data call, etc., the weighing instrument has more powerful functions to adapt to the characteristics of crane lifting operations. At the same time, the instrument can also be connected to the large screen to achieve the large screen display of weight data.

Crane positioning measurement is a set of automatic detection system for the data acquisition of crane scales. According to the process flow, the operation process of the crane is automatically tracked and intelligent analyzed, so as to realize the automatic data statistics of the crane scale. Instead of the heavy work of scribes and human negligence caused by report data inaccurate, false report, missing report phenomenon. One computer can accept the signals of multiple cranes at the same time, and realize the automatic measurement of the whole system.

When the crane positioning device reaches a specific location, the crane automatic metering system identifies the location through the location identifier. The control unit will receive the weight signal and position signal package through the radio to the computer control part. The control unit accepts the command sent by the computer and executes the corresponding action, while sending an alarm when the value exceeds the set range. Location Identification Part This part consists of location identification distributed at specific locations on the site or on the truck. The location identifier is used by the positioning device on the vehicle to identify the location. Computer control Part of the computer receives the information from the radio station in the sky, and automatically determines which operation is carried out through the set program, and automatically records the relevant weight. The computer control part can also send zero, peel, reset and other commands to the crane.


Operation management of belt scale in dosage system
The belt scale receives the speed signal of SR and the weight signal, calculates the instantaneous flow rate of the material on the belt and displays it, compares the actual value of the flow rate with the set value of the flow rate, and through PID regulation, the output current control signal is amplified by the preamplifier and the power amplifier Q to control the conduction angle of the SCR VT and thus regulate the rotational speed of the sliding motor M, so as to make the material flow rate stabilize at the expected set value.
Application of weighing modules in large storage tanks
Weighing modules can be used as storage and irrigation materials in and out of the warehouse measurement, can also be used for process flow control, in general, according to the shape of the tank and the installation of different ways to choose 3 or 4 weighing modules to complete, especially suitable for chemical plant production process quantitative feeding system occasions to use.
Screw dosage system technology application
Screw automatic dosage system is the ideal equipment for continuous dosage and measurement of bulk materials, which can set high, middle and low feeding, and then control the feeding speed of screw feeder, so as to achieve the purpose of accurate dosage. According to the actual process of batching process, it reflects the operation status of feeding, batching, feeding and related equipment in the form of dynamic screen.
